What miniatures are included in the set?
The set includes 19 multipart plastic miniatures: 1 Captain in Gravis Armour, 3 Bladeguard Veterans, 5 Hellblasters, and 10 Intercessors. It also includes 2 Dark Angels Primaris Upgrade frames and 3 Dark Angels transfer sheets.
Are the models pre-assembled or pre-painted?
No, the miniatures are supplied unpainted and require assembly. They are multipart plastic kits that need to be glued together. Games Workshop recommends using Citadel Plastic Glue and Citadel Colour paints.
Does this set include the rules for playing?
The physical box does not contain a rulebook. However, the free Combat Patrol rules, which include the specific rules for using this set as the 'Vengeful Brethren' detachment, can be downloaded from the Warhammer Community website.

Can I use these models in a standard Warhammer 40,000 game, not just Combat Patrol?
Yes, absolutely. While the set is curated for the Combat Patrol game format, all the units (Captain, Bladeguard Veterans, Hellblasters, and Intercessors) are standard units from the Space Marines and Dark Angels codexes and can be used in any size of Warhammer 40,000 game.
What is the purpose of the upgrade frames and transfer sheets?
The two Dark Angels Primaris Upgrade frames provide specialised shoulder pads, weapons, heads, and other accessories to visually customise your Intercessors and other Primaris units with Dark Angels iconography. The three transfer sheets contain a variety of printed chapter, company, and squad markings to apply to the models after painting.
Is this a good set for someone completely new to Warhammer 40,000?
Yes, the Combat Patrol sets are designed as an ideal starting point. This Dark Angels box provides a complete, playable army in one purchase, along with a direct link to the free, simplified Combat Patrol rules. It offers a manageable modelling project and a ready-made force for learning the game.
